Sound Mixer/Boom Op Needed - 10min Short Film – Camber Sands, 28th/29th JULY – LOW PAY
Carsick Pictures are shooting a 10 minute short film, on DigiBeta at Camber Sands, South England all day Saturday 28th and Sunday 29th July.
'Underwater' tells the story of an estranged Rockstar and the troubled young Croatian girl who rescues him from drowning.
We need an experienced BOOM OPERATOR/SOUND MIXER to record sound on the shoot. Microphone/Boom and Sound Mixer etc can be provided, but it would be preferred if you have your own gear. A small hire fee can be paid if you do have your own equipment.
We are paying UKP60 per day, plus travel expenses and food. Apologies for the low rate of pay, as the film is self funded, this the absolute maximum we can stretch to. We will be shooting at sunrise on Sunday morning so you will be provided with hotel accommodation near the location on Saturday night (unless you live close to Camber Sands).
We are extremely happy with the script and anticipate it will do well on the European festival circuit. We have promises of post production help from a number of large post houses in Soho so rest assured this will be a high quality production. Above all else we are excited to be making the film and want everyone we work with to share that excitement!
